    QUALITY TECH PURPOSE This role is to provide quality inspection, continuous improvement, and general quality support within the organization. This position requires attention to detail, ability to understand and follow established processes, and product evaluation skills. A successful candidate will be competent in reading and understanding basic blueprints and completing routine inspections. ESSENTIAL DUTIES The Quality Technician may be responsible for performing any of the following types of inspections: Incoming Inspections: evaluate incoming materials and components for conformance to specific criteria. Incoming inspections will be performed using dimensional, visual, and process related criteria to determine suitability for use. A base understanding of metrology, traceability, and product preservation is required for this function. In-process Inspections: evaluate product in various stages of the process either internally or after being processed by a third party. Accurate recordkeeping and an understanding of proper document control practices is essential to success in this role Final Inspections: evaluation of product prior to release for shipment to the customer. This will include assisting with completing and compiling documentation for First Article Inspection packets as well as production inspection records. Ability to interact with all areas of production to maintain efficient product throughput. Review production records for accuracy and compliance. Ability to work in clean room environment including adherence to gowning, cleanliness, and procedural standards. Work with a high level of precision and detail. How much does a quality technician earn in Muncie, IN?

The average quality technician in Muncie, IN earns between $22,000 and $42,000 annually. This compares to the national average quality technician range of $27,000 to $50,000.
